I have just picked up a Pro-197 scanner and I have my local system programmed in it (Central Maryland Radio Committe 700 MHZ APCO-25) the radio will scan and stop on a channel, I can see that it is receiving something but I cannot hear anything. The signal master jumps around (it doesn’t stay steady on a certain reading) I know the speaker works, the radio will revive stations just fine when I turn the volume up I just hear a light hissing sound.

700 Mhz

Good Morning 1977addis. If you are familiar enough with the Pro 197, you may want to consider running a Limit Search for say, 768.0000 thru 775.0000. If you do that the 197 is great for landing on any control channels that lie in within range of your system. That will give you an excellent idea of what you can receive and decode, and what you may not be able to. It could simply be that the transmitter is just a little far away to receive all of the data, most likely an encryption though. Hope this helps, take care up there
